What M&T BANK CORP does

M&T is a New York business corporation that has elected to be treated as an FHC under the BHCA and is a BHC under Article III-A of the New York Banking Law. M&T was incorporated in November 1969. At December 31, 2025, M&T had two wholly-owned bank subsidiaries: M&T Bank and Wilmington Trust, N.A. The banks collectively offer a wide range of retail and commercial banking, wealth management, trust and institutional services to their customers. The Company had consolidated total assets of $213.5 billion, deposits of $166.9 billion and shareholders’ equity of $29.2 billion at December 31, 2025. The principal executive offices of M&T and M&T Bank are located in Buffalo, New York. M&T Bank is a banking corporation that is incorporated under the laws of the State of New York.
